Should you send it on the 3rd hole at Augusta to the front right pin?
Yes.
Proximity numbers are for where 2nd shot ended up.
The image below has players that went for it on the left, and players that laid back on the right. You can compare stats from each group.
Any way you look at it players that "went for it" beat players that laid up.

@MGAPGAPRO @USGA@RandA It’s already capped. They can tighten if they want, but there is no rational argument to go backwards. Ball speeds are going to self-regulate. There is a point of diminishing returns where the misses become too great to be playable. Guys over 190 are starting to already hit this
@MGAPGAPRO @USGA@RandA That changed mainly due to other factors besides equipment. The level of athlete changed after Tiger. The relationship of distance to scoring was better understood. Course conditions at the elite level are conducive to distance. Launch monitor optimization. Etc
@MGAPGAPRO @USGA@RandA It’s not the same. The groove change didn’t impact average players because most of them don’t have the proper technique to spin the ball correctly anyway, regardless of grooves (and many were still legally using older grooves for years). The ball change will impact them
@MGAPGAPRO @jesse_polk@USGA@RandA Elite players do not bomb and gouge it. That’s a myth. They are incredibly accurate if you compare how far offline their drives are as a percentage of how far they hit it when compared to shorter hitters.
